My SotC Project/Challenge: 28 Characters
When discussing SotC with the players, one thing I've pointed out is that there are no throw-away skills. A character could have any one of the skills as Superb, be built around that, and rock. The authors provided a set of stunts for each skill and, as I mentioned in a previous entry, copious advice on a skill-by-skill basis on how to use those skills to make the character interesting.
So, here's my project for the next month. I'll be taking the list of 28 skills and creating a character built around each one. It'll be a good exercise for me to get to know the system in depth. I'll be posting the characters on my LJ, and updating this list with links to the entries.
